Dr. Rajan Mahtani Wins Major Forbes Philanthropy Award

Noted businessman and philanthropist Dr. Rajan Lekhraj Mahtani is one of the winners of the Forbes ‘Best of Africa’ award ceremony. It is one of the most prestigious and notable philanthropy awards in Zambia. The Forbes ‘Best of Africa’ awards is presented by Forbes which is one of the top business magazines across the globe. Forbes is known for several lists and rankings such as ranking of entrepreneurs, businesses, leaders, and other categories. Also, the selection process for the Forbes ‘Best of Africa’ award winners is extremely rigorous yet transparent. The process comprises of months of verification process and background checking. This is followed by interviews and discussions with the potential awardees to understand their perceptions and views regarding philanthropy as a means to achieve long-term empowerment of the African nation. The award ceremony was part of the annual Forbes-FIN philanthropy and leadership roundtable conference which was held virtually. Members participated in this virtual roundtable conference from their respective locations. Dr. Rajan Lekhraj Mahtani was also invited in this event as an honorary speaker and discussed about the significance of leadership in healthcare.

In a similar fashion, Dr. Rajan Mahtani was selected for the Forbes ‘Best of Africa’ awards. Forbes recognised the contributions made by Dr. Rajan Mahtani, especially towards redefining the banking sector of Zambia and conferred him with the Forbes ‘Outstanding Entrepreneur of the Year’ award 2021. Dr. Mahtani has made several investments and contributions to Zambia over the past four decades. Dr. Mahtani has been working towards the growth and development of the Zambia nation. To achieve this, Dr. Mahtani worked towards developing his business and corporate contributions as well as his philanthropic contributions. As such, his contributions were finally recognized by Forbes with an award at an international level. Some of his top philanthropic contributions included Prison Fellowship Zambia as well as Stephen Malama award and scholarship for top law graduates in Zambia.
